Tauranga Police CIB Auction
Tauranga Police CIB charity auction October 2009.
The luncheon and auction raised $75,000 for Tauranga RDA Arena Charitable Trust to build new Indoor Arena.
|
 |
2011 the Tauranga Police CIB charity auction raised $100,000 towards the completion of the Indoor Arena. |

Pub Charity
We are extremely grateful for the recent support received from Pub Charity.
They have granted us $20,000 to go towards the costs associated with providing equestrian therapy sessions. These funds will be applied to operational and salary costs.
Pub Charity have been a consistent supporter of RDA Tauranga and their support has made a great difference to the level of programming we are able to offer those who need it within our community.
We thank the trustees of Pub Charity most sincerely for their support.

Southern Trust
Southern Trust have again this year agreed to provide a grant to go towards the costs of the salaries of our coaches, Jessie Vale and Sharon Aldersley.
Their grant of $10,000 is a major factor in our capacity to deliver equestrian therapy sessions and to meet the growing needs within our community.
We thank the trustees of Southern Trust most sincerely for their support.
